Pre-Popping Chemistry, Equipment, and Ingredient Calibration
Successfully making spicy popcorn requires an understanding of starch chemistry and lipid behavior. Popcorn kernels (specifically the Zea mays everta variety) contain approximately 14% water locked inside a dense starch endosperm, surrounded by a hard outer hull called the pericarp. When heat is applied, this internal moisture vaporizes into steam, gelatinizing the starch. When internal pressure reaches roughly 135 pounds per square inch (psi) at a temperature of 356°F (180°C), the pericarp ruptures. The gelatinized starch expands outward into a delicate, airy foam that instantly solidifies upon contact with cooler air.
Introducing moisture at this delicate stage collapses the expanded starch matrix, turning the popcorn tough, chewy, or soggy. This is why liquid hot sauces (which are primarily water and vinegar) cannot be applied directly to popped corn without destroying its texture. Instead, flavor developers must utilize fat-soluble heat agents suspended in dry spice matrices or hydrophobic oils. Capsaicin—the chemical compound responsible for the heat in chili peppers—is hydrophobic, meaning it dissolves beautifully in fats and oils but repels water. Leveraging fat-soluble spices ensures a fiery flavor profile without compromising structural crunch.
Essential Equipment Checklist
- Heavy-Bottomed 6-Quart Stockpot or Whirley Pop: A heavy multi-clad stainless steel or cast-iron pot ensures even heat distribution, preventing localized hot spots that scorch kernels.
- Vented Lid or Fine-Mesh Splatter Screen: Essential for allowing water vapor to escape during the popping phase, preventing steam from re-condensing on the popped kernels.
- High-Speed Spice Grinder or Mortar and Pestle: Used to reduce standard crystalline salt and dried spices down to an ultra-fine, micronized dust.
- Large Stainless Steel Mixing Bowl: A wide, deep bowl provides the surface area required to toss and coat the popcorn evenly without crushing the fragile popped structures.
- Fine-Mesh Sifter: For distributing the micronized seasoning evenly over the popcorn, avoiding heavy clumps.
Ingredient and Ratio Specifications
- Popcorn Kernels: 1/2 cup (approximately 100 grams) of fresh, high-quality butterfly or mushroom kernels. Butterfly kernels offer more surface area for dry spices to cling to; mushroom kernels are sturdier and resist crushing.
- Popping Fat: 3 tablespoons of high-smoke-point oil (refined coconut oil, ghee, or avocado oil).
- Lipid Binder: 2 to 3 tablespoons of warm clarified butter (ghee) or a high-quality aerosolized oil spray. Clarified butter is crucial because standard butter contains 16% to 18% water, which will instantly wilt popcorn.
- Spicy Seasoning Matrix: 1.5 tablespoons of custom spicy dust (consisting of fine sea salt, cayenne pepper, smoked paprika, garlic powder, onion powder, and optionally, MSG or nutritional yeast for savory depth).
The Culinary Protocol for Executing Perfect Spicy Popcorn
Step 1: Formulating and Micronizing the Spicy Seasoning Matrix
Standard table salt has a particle size of roughly 150 to 300 microns, which is far too heavy to adhere to the dry surface of a popped kernel. Without a liquid binder, gravity pulls these heavy crystals directly to the bottom of the bowl. To ensure complete coverage, you must reduce your spices to a microscopic powder (under 50 microns) that can lodge within the microscopic crevices of the popcorn's expanded starch.
Combine 1 teaspoon of fine sea salt, 1 teaspoon of cayenne pepper (adjust based on heat preference), 1 teaspoon of smoked sweet paprika (for color and depth), 1/2 teaspoon of garlic powder, and 1/2 teaspoon of onion powder in a high-speed spice grinder. Process the mixture on high for 30 to 45 seconds until it resembles a fine, flour-like dust.
Warning: When opening the spice grinder lid after processing hot peppers, do not inhale directly over the container. The aerosolized capsaicin dust can cause severe respiratory irritation and coughing. Allow the dust to settle for 60 seconds before opening.
Step 2: Calibrating the Thermal Medium and Oil Dispersion
Place your heavy-bottomed pot over medium-high heat. Add 3 tablespoons of your chosen popping fat. To ensure the oil is at the exact thermodynamic threshold required for instantaneous popping without burning, place exactly three test kernels into the cold oil and cover the pot with your vented lid.
As the pot heats, watch and listen for these test kernels to pop. This occurs when the oil temperature reaches approximately 375°F (190°C).
Pro-Tip: If you wish to infuse the heat directly into the core of the popcorn, you can add 1/4 teaspoon of ground cayenne pepper directly to the cooking oil during this heating phase. However, do not add garlic or onion powders to the hot oil, as their sugars will scorch at 375°F, producing a bitter, acrid taste.
Step 3: Executing the Popping Phase and Steam Depressurization
As soon as the three test kernels have popped, the oil is at its optimal thermal state. Quickly pour in the remaining 1/2 cup of popcorn kernels, shaking the pot vigorously in a horizontal motion to distribute the kernels into a single, uniform layer. This ensures that every kernel is completely coated in hot oil, which guarantees even heat conduction.
Return the pot to the burner and position the lid so it is slightly ajar—roughly a quarter of an inch. This gap is critical: it allows steam to escape continuously while keeping flying kernels contained. Alternatively, use a fine-mesh splatter screen.
Gently shake the pot back and forth across the burner every 10 seconds. This prevents kernels from sitting in one place and burning against the hot bottom of the pot. Within 60 to 90 seconds, popping will begin rapidly. Continue shaking the pot regularly. As soon as the popping frequency slows to 2 to 3 seconds between pops, immediately remove the pot from the heat source and dump the popcorn into your large stainless steel mixing bowl.
Step 4: The Lipid-Binder Application and Layered Seasoning Dusting
The window of opportunity to apply seasoning is immediately after popping, while the popcorn is still radiating heat. The remaining heat helps dry spices adhere and assists in drawing the lipid binder across the surface of the popped corn.
Do not dump all your spice powder or liquid fat onto the popcorn at once, as this will create saturated, soggy pockets and leave other areas completely bare. Instead, use a dual-handed, layered approach.
With one hand, drizzle a very thin stream of warm clarified butter (ghee) or spray a light mist of aerosolized oil over the popcorn while simultaneously using your other hand to toss the popcorn in the bowl with a flipping motion. Immediately after the first light coat of fat, shake a portion of your micronized spice blend through a fine-mesh sifter over the tumbling popcorn. Repeat this process in three distinct stages: drizzle/spray, toss, sift spices, and repeat. This systematic layering guarantees that every single kernel receives an even distribution of both lipid binder and spicy seasoning.

Popcorn Fat Media and Heat-Binding Specifications
Choosing the right fat medium dictates both the physical crunch of your popcorn and how well the spicy seasoning sticks to it. The table below compares the most effective oils and fats used in gourmet popcorn production, detailing their smoke points, viscosity profiles, and spice-adherence performance.
| Cooking Fat / Lipid Binder | Smoke Point (°F / °C) | Viscosity Level at Room Temp | Flavor Profile | Spice Adhesion Rating (1-10) | Ideal Spicy Ingredient Pairing |
|---|---|---|---|---|---|
| Ghee (Clarified Butter) | 485°F / 252°C | Low (when warm) | Rich, nutty, deep butter notes | 9.5 / 10 | Ghost pepper powder, smoked chipotle, sea salt |
| Refined Coconut Oil | 450°F / 232°C | Medium-Low | Neutral, faint sweetness | 9.0 / 10 | Cayenne, ground cumin, lime zest |
| Avocado Oil | 520°F / 271°C | Low | Very neutral, clean finish | 8.5 / 10 | Habanero powder, garlic, nutritional yeast |
| Canola / Grapeseed Oil | 400°F / 204°C | Low | Flat, completely neutral | 7.5 / 10 | Standard chili powder, onion salt |
| Extra Virgin Olive Oil | 375°F / 190°C | Medium | Peppery, grassy, robust | 8.0 / 10 | Crushed red pepper flakes, dry oregano, parmesan |
Diagnostic Troubleshooting for Soggy or Bland Spicy Popcorn
Failure 1: The popped corn is tough, rubbery, or has lost its crispness.
- Root Cause: Excess moisture has re-entered the popped corn's porous starch structure. This typically happens because the pot lid was kept sealed tight during popping, trapping steam inside, or because a water-based liquid binder (such as standard butter, hot sauce, or lime juice) was applied directly to the popped corn.
- Actionable Fix: Always ensure your cooking vessel is vented during popping to let steam escape. If your lid isn't vented, use a mesh splatter screen instead. For your liquid binder, never use raw butter or water-based hot sauces; instead, use clarified butter (ghee) or high-quality spray oils that have zero water content.
Failure 2: The spicy seasoning pools at the bottom of the bowl and won't stick to the popcorn.
- Root Cause: The spices are too coarse and heavy, or they were applied to dry popcorn without a fat-based binder. Standard spices suffer from gravity pull because there is no surface tension to hold them to the smooth, dry starch of the popped kernel.
- Actionable Fix: Grind your salt and spices in a high-speed spice grinder until they are a fine powder (like flour). Apply a warm lipid binder (like ghee or cooking spray) to the popcorn before adding the spices, and apply the spices through a fine-mesh sifter while tossing the popcorn to distribute them evenly.
Failure 3: The spicy seasoning tastes bitter, acrid, or burnt.
- Root Cause: Delicate ground spices (such as garlic powder, onion powder, or paprika) were added directly to the hot oil at the beginning of the popping process. These spices contain sugars and volatile oils that scorch and turn bitter when exposed to temperatures above 350°F (177°C).
- Actionable Fix: Only pop the kernels in pure, unseasoned oil (or oil infused briefly with whole spices that are strained out before popping). Always apply your fine seasoning powders after the popcorn has finished popping and has been transferred to a mixing bowl.
Frequently Asked Questions
Why does my spicy seasoning fall off the popcorn?
Dry spices fall off popcorn because their particles are too heavy and the popcorn's surface is too dry to hold them. To fix this, grind your salt and spices into a micro-fine powder and apply a light mist of water-free oil or melted ghee to act as a sticky binder before dusting the spices on.
What is the best oil for making spicy popcorn on the stove?
Refined coconut oil and ghee (clarified butter) are the best choices because they have high smoke points (above 450°F/232°C) and carry fat-soluble spicy compounds, like capsaicin, beautifully across your palate. They also deliver a classic cinema-style flavor without burning.
How do I make spicy popcorn without oil?
To make oil-free spicy popcorn, pop your kernels using a hot-air popper. Immediately after popping, lightly spray the popcorn with a fine mist of low-sodium liquid aminos, diluted hot sauce, or lime juice from a fine-mist spray bottle, then quickly dust on your micro-fine spices so they stick before the moisture softens the popcorn.
Can I use fresh chili peppers or hot sauce directly on popcorn?
Using fresh chili peppers or wet hot sauce directly on popped corn is not recommended because their high water content will instantly melt the crisp starch structure, leaving you with soggy popcorn. Instead, sauté fresh chilis in your cooking oil first to infuse the fat with heat, strain out the solids, and use that spicy infused oil to pop your kernels.
How do I store leftover spicy popcorn to keep it crispy?
Let the spiced popcorn cool completely to room temperature so no residual steam builds up, then store it in an airtight glass container or a heavy-duty zip-top bag with all the air squeezed out. For best results, tuck a food-safe silica gel packet inside the container to absorb any migrating moisture.
